Eucalyptus Lawn

The Eucalyptus Lawn is the main open area of the Gardens, and features a rotunda, erected in 2003 to mark the 50th anniversary of the Raymond Terrace Rotary Club. The lawn and rotunda are a popular venue for fairs, musical events and weddings.

The Eucalytus Lawn features naturally growing Blackbutts (Eucalyptus pilularis), which are the dominant tree species on the Gardens site, along with a number of other local Eucalyptus tree species. Several local eucalyptus species are also grown in the car park.
